Cropping Images before Printing
Still Images Movies
By cropping images before printing, you can print a desired image area instead of the entire image.
1 Choose [Cropping].
●●After following step 1 in “Configuring Print Settings” (=167) to access the printing screen, choose [Cropping] and press the [] button.
●●A cropping frame is now displayed, indicating the image area to print.
2 Adjust the cropping frame as needed.
●●To resize the frame, move the zoom lever.
●●To move the frame, press the [][][][] buttons.
●●To rotate the frame, press the [] button.
●●Press the [] button, press the
[][] buttons to choose [OK], and then press the [] button.
3 Print the image.
●●Follow step 6 in “Easy Print” (=166) to print.
●● Cropping may not be possible at small image sizes, or at some aspect ratios.
●● Dates may not be printed correctly if you crop images shot with [Date Stamp ] selected.
